Anti-Lock Brake System (ABS) Module
The ABS module uses the high speed CAN for communication with the diagnostic tool and other modules on the high speed CAN. The ABS module controls the brake pressure to the 4 wheels to keep the vehicle under control while braking.
Check the high speed CAN circuits between the ABS module C135 and the DLC C251. The total resistance values must not be more than 5 ohms. If the resistance is more than 5 ohms, there is an open circuit in the high speed CAN, damage to the DLC C251, damage to the ABS module C135, or a problem in the in-line connector.
